The weekly Alabama Sports Writers Association high school football poll was released Wednesday morning.
Clay-Chalkville remains at No. 1 in the Class 6A poll after a dominant victory over Mountain Brook.
Hewitt-Trussville's run at No. 1 will last only one week, as the Huskies drop to No. 4 after losing to Thompson.
Both teams are back in action Friday, with Clay heading to Huffman and Hewitt traveling to Prattville.
The full Class 6A and 7A poll:
CLASS 7A
Team (first-place); W-L; Pts
1. Central-Phenix City (9); 6-1; 189
2. Thompson (8); 5-2; 179
3. Mary Montgomery (1); 7-0; 142
4. Hewitt-Trussville; 6-1; 129
5. Opelika; 6-1; 89
6. Vestavia Hills; 4-2; 83
7. Carver-Montgomery; 5-1; 72
8. Auburn; 5-2; 54
9. Daphne; 6-1; 49
10. Hoover; 4-3; 26
Others receiving votes: Fairhope (6-1) 10, Dothan (3-3) 2, Baker (4-2) 1, Hillcrest-Tuscaloosa (5-2) 1.
CLASS 6A
Team (first-place); W-L; Pts
1. Clay-Chalkville (17); 7-0; 213
2. Saraland (1); 6-0; 161
3. Muscle Shoals; 6-0; 124
4. Hartselle; 6-0; 117
5. Parker; 5-2; 115
6. Benjamin Russell; 6-1; 97
7. Russell Co.; 7-0; 63
8. Pike Road; 5-2; 49
9. Spain Park; 4-2; 41
10. Homewood; 6-1; 24
Others receiving votes: Jasper (6-0) 12, McAdory (5-0) 8, St. Paul's (5-1) 2.
